As the needs of Ngāpuhi change so will the role of the Rūnanga. But in the short term there are new challenges for it to undertake.
Future projects include:
- Collecting, recording and distributing our stories and histories, which are fundamental to defining who we are as Ngāpuhi people.
- Developing closer relations with hapū, working with them to establish key fundamentals and projects that promote and further their wellbeing.
- Identifying and developing local economic initiatives.
- Assisting local Māori in natural resource management.
- Capturing the essence of our Ngāpuhitanga, and promoting and enhancing it: within Te Whare Tapu o Ngāpuhi, nationally and globally.
- Working side-by-side with key stakeholders like government agencies to ensure the future wellbeing of our tangata.
These are just some of the future projects. However more can be expected to come forth as we move forward.
